Do you mean standards/targets/objectives?Kellyh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/11326885994253114227no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-125924428790346569.post-51035955234156253672007-08-07T08:52:00.000-04:002007-08-07T08:52:00.000-04:00An example would be getting all 4 content areas to...An example would be getting all 4 content areas together to discuss and share ideas on how they can ALL get through their curriculum while also focusing on the same theme or topic.<BR/><BR/>For example, we did the Florida Habitat Unit where the kids had to research the habitats in Florida and research the organisms that live in those habitats while in science. In social studies, the kids studied the human environment, native americans that inhabited Florida as well as the human impact on our environment. In Language Arts, students could read an ecological based novel, such as "Hoot". In math, students can practice with graphs of population sizes, ratios and percentages with an "ecological focus". <BR/><BR/>While at the International Baccalaureate conference this summer, we worked with a diverse group to come up with a collaborative unit on death.
